The Baptist church procedures the communion as 1 of its two acts of faith-obedience. Much of the time, this is named an “ordinance” rather than a “sacrament.” In other words and phrases, you can’t receive salvation or grace via communion. Instead, these are purely symbolic acts that were commanded of Christ’s followers by Christ Himself. This is truly the 2nd ordinance in the Baptist church and it is patterned right after the Very last Supper, which was recorded in the Gospels wherein Jesus suggests to “do this in remembrance of me.” With this in thoughts, contributors in communion split and take in bread and drink a modest “shot of wine.” These objects are symbolic of the entire body and the blood of Jesus, respectively.

Usually, Baptists serve communion to participants wherever they are seated. Even so, it is up to every personal church how communion is arranged, due to the fact the arrangement itself has no theological importance. Far more essential than seating or arrangement is the communion alone. For occasion, the bread utilized is unleavened, as it is thought that this is the variety of bread the would have been served at the Previous Supper. As these kinds of, bread cubes, wafers or modest crackers are handed all around on plates to those who want to participate in communion. Of course, it is also suitable to do the “breaking of bread” from loaves, as nicely.

The cup is loaded with unfermented grape juice. However, the Gospel passages only mention the “fruit of the vine.” It is by no means called wine therein. Generally little specific cups are used to signify the “cup.” A “typical cup” that the total congregation beverages from can be utilized, but it is usually reserved for tiny gatherings for functional reasons.

Most of the time, the two the bread and the wine are served by the pastor to the deacons. The deacons then serve the congregation, adopted by the pastor. In baptist church in Raleigh , the pastors may often provide one particular another, permitting the deacons to emphasis on serving the congregation. Once the complete congregation has been served, everybody will take the elements at the identical time. This symbolizes unity.
